For those planning to buy tickets at the station, the ticket office at Hillington West operates from 07:10 to 14:14 on weekdays and Saturdays, although it's closed on Sundays. No need to worry about buying your tickets in advance since ticket machines are available and can also assist with the collection of tickets purchased online. The station supports accessible travel with step-free access and induction loops. However, be cautious as the stepping distance between train and platform is slightly larger at some points.
One must note that there are some facilities that you might miss at Hillington West. The station does not have toilets, baby changing facilities, refreshment services, or Wi-Fi on-site. Furthermore, accessibility support includes help points, and a notable absence of waiting rooms, accessible toilets, or accessible taxis. For those cycling, there are bicycle stands, albeit without shelters or CCTV coverage.
Once you alight at Hillington West, moving to your next destination is straightforward. The station provides a bus stop pickup and drop-off on Queen Elizabeth Avenue, making it simple to catch a bus. For updated bus service details, visiting Travel Line Scotland online or calling their 24-hour service is recommended. Taxis can also be arranged via Train Taxi, offering another convenient travel option. Operating with customer convenience in mind, Glengarnock Train Station offers robust facilities for both ticket purchasing and passenger support. The ticket office is open from Monday to Saturday, 07:15 to 14:19, though it's closed on Sundays.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available and are accessible to all customers, including those with mobility impairments.
The station is fitted with helpful customer information systems, including departure screens and audio announcements. For further assistance, the staff is present during weekdays with a customer help point readily available for queries. Notably, the station integrates accessibility features like step-free access to certain areas, induction loops, seating areas, and ramps, ensuring a more seamless travel experience for everyone.
Glengarnock is well-connected with several transport options to ease your onward journey. Local buses are conveniently accessed from the Main Street, B777, and details about these services can be found on Traveline Scotland. Should you need a taxi, services can be arranged via TrainTaxi. Additionally, the station accommodates bicycle enthusiasts with storage facilities and the option to hire bicycles from RT Cycles & Fishing located nearby.
Parking is no hassle with accessible and free spaces available 24 hours a day. Despite lacking direct accessible taxis, travelers can plan their route with confidence using the assistance program, Passenger Assist, which allows bookings up to two hours before travel.
